Best blending brush for hooded eyes. Eyeliner is the Achilles heel of the hooded eyelid. Too much and the eyes can look smaller, and smudging is often inescapable. "Find one that dries quickly and practice," says Emma. "I prefer a gel liner with a fine thin brush." For this reason, tightlining is a great technique to learn. For crease work, particularly for hooded eyes, you want a brush that is both dense and super fluffy to really blend the colour out. You can’t go wrong with MAC’s 217 brush , or, as a cheaper alternative, Makeup Geek’s Soft Dome brush is my all-time favourite. They’re VERY affordable (around $3 each), very soft, don’t shed, blend eyeshadows like magic, and most importantly, the tapered brush fits in the crease of my hooded eyes perfectly! Legendary makeup artist Lisa Eldridge is of the opinion that we should all probably be using bigger, softer brushes to apply our eye makeup and achieve a more subtle, blended finish, but this is especially true where hooded eyes are concerned. MAC 213 Fluff Brush, £17, is your makeup magic wand in this case. Using a soft, synthetic blending brush, blend the eyeshadow just enough to blur the edges while still keeping the shadow on the outer corner of your eye. Using a Larger Brush, Blend the Shadow Over the Rest of the Lid. Using a larger blending brush, blend out the shadow from the corner of the lid to the crease and to the rest of the lid.
